Close button
A generic close button for dismissing content like modals and alerts.

Example

Provide an option to dismiss or close a component with .btn-close. Default styling is limited, but highly customizable. Modify the Sass variables to replace the default background-image. Be sure to include text for screen readers, as we've done with aria-label.

Disabled state

Disabled close buttons change their opacity. We've also applied pointer-events: none and user-select: none to preventing hover and active states from triggering.

Dark variant

{{< deprecated-in "5.0.0" >}}

{{< callout warning >}} Heads up! As of v5.0.0, the .btn-close-white class is deprecated. Instead, use data-coreui-theme="dark" to change the color mode of the close button. {{< /callout >}}

Add data-coreui-theme="dark" to the .btn-close, or to its parent element, to invert the close button. This uses the filter property to invert the background-image without overriding its value.
